About the role
This position is listed on behalf of a partner company, who manages all applications and next steps. Our partner is looking for a Product Marketing Director, Velocity based in the United States.
Responsibilities
- Define and execute the go-to-market strategy for SMB and Mid-Market offerings, including customer segmentation, positioning, messaging, and competitive differentiation.
- Lead cross-functional product launches in collaboration with Product Management, Sales, Demand Generation, Regional Marketing, and Channel teams to ensure successful market adoption.
- Develop scalable sales enablement materials, partner resources, messaging frameworks, and marketing assets that support consistent global execution.
- Analyze customer feedback, competitive trends, market dynamics, and win/loss data to identify growth opportunities and influence product strategy.
- Partner with revenue teams to improve pipeline generation, customer acquisition, expansion opportunities, and competitive positioning.
- Establish performance metrics and best practices to continuously enhance go-to-market effectiveness and operational excellence across velocity-focused business segments.
Requirements
- 10+ years of experience in B2B product marketing, go-to-market strategy, or solutions marketing, including leadership experience managing product marketing teams.
- Proven success developing and executing GTM strategies for SMB, Commercial, or Mid-Market technology products.
- Strong expertise in product positioning, messaging, product launches, competitive analysis, and sales enablement.
- Experience collaborating with Product Management, Sales, Demand Generation, Channel organizations, and executive leadership.
- Excellent strategic thinking, executive communication, analytical, and stakeholder management skills.
- Experience within enterprise software, SaaS, cloud infrastructure, cybersecurity, data protection, or related technology industries is highly preferred.
